Discount for current students about to graduate and alumni
Graduates from the University of Cumbria or any of its legacy institutions may be eligible for a fee discount of up to £741 on postgraduate taught courses. To be eligible, you must be a UK or EU graduate who studied at the University of Cumbria or a legacy institution for more than 6 months.

Funding
The UK government does not usually fund students who are studying at postgraduate level. Some courses, for example Social Work and some Health Professions Masters degrees do attract some funding.
